IFMA Teams to Form Pact for Sustainable Facility Skills
The International Facility Management Association (IFMA), an international association for professional facility managers with more than 19,000 members in 60 countries, joined two stakeholders in the European built environment to form the Pact for Skills for Sustainable Facilities in Europe.
The agreement calls for IFMA’s Europe, Middle East, and Africa (EMEA)—IFMA EMEA—to team with the Representatives of European Heating and Ventilation Associations (REHVA) and the European Building Automation Controls Association (EU.BAC) to provide ongoing education, certification, and training to facility management professionals. The three organizations will also advance awareness of building operations performance and develop training resources for the European regions.
“Continuing education has always been important to building sector professionals, but even more so now amid rapidly advancing technologies, elevated focus on occupant well-being, and a global urgency to reduce buildings’ environmental impact,” said Lara Paemen, IFMA EMEA managing director.
